Transaction 41a160a60a7b04ddc8fd2458ce4346ffc67c875f5f62b38c42840b48cc653ba9

1 Input
1 Outputs
  • 41a160a60a7b04ddc8fd2458ce4346ffc67c875f5f62b38c42840b48cc653ba9:0
  • value  2357743
    address  3BM8CR8dgNEkKKLZvqTfKYHM9bwbddCCdt